Ibm object rexx for windows development edition nathan

It looks like you are new to the whole information technology. It is a followon to and a significant extension of the classic rexx language originally created for the conversational monitor system cms component of the operating system vmsp and later ported to multiple virtual storage, os2 and pc dos. Open object rexx ibm resource workshop object rexx workbench. Object rexx for windows nt and windows 95 ibm itso red book ueli. Rexx has long been considered one of the fastest development languages for system exit and utilities work on zos. The zos adcd can run under the ibms system z personal development tool zpdt. Ibm contributes source code of the object rexx interpreter edition to the. External functions functions that are not a builtin part of rexx. This implementation includes a windows script host wsh scripting engine for rexx. The system z processor can support very large memory. Proprietary and open source rexx interpreters exist for a wide range of computing platforms. Program part description number number object rexx for windows v2.

Implementing rexx support in sdsf june 2007 international technical support organization sg24741900. Your contribution will go a long way in helping us. Ibm object rexx is an objectoriented programming language suited for. Part name number object rexx for windows development edition ba86hie english doc pack object rexx for windows development edition ba82sie v2. Ibm object rexx for windows development edition update 2. Hi all, a quick introduction im new to the mainframe and im working in a team of experienced mainframe system programmers and have been learning some of the basics of ispftsomvs and im looking to expand my knowledge of rexx and utility programming in general. For the similarly named digital research operating system, see cpm.

Ibm mainframe rexx programming test created by experts smes. It is upwardly compatible with classic open object rexx browse oorexx4. These are collectively called the sa iom rexx api application programming interface. The speaker will also discuss the coding techniques used in developing the code including common rexx coding constructs such as parsing and stem variables as well as using more advanced techniques like the rexx socket api, rexx with unix system services, sdsf rexx and using rexx. Since then it has been ported to aix, linux, and sun solaris.

Interium builds for the next version of oorexx are available on the oorexx build machine. Ibm compiler and library for rexx on ibm z facilitates your rexx scripting and app development and runtime. Ingo holder is a software engineer at ibms german software development lab in boeblingen, germany. Object rexx for windows development edition software subscription and support reinstatement 1 year overview and full product specs on cnet. Finally, every even halfway serious rexx programmer should have a copy of the rexx reference summary handbook by dick goran. The source code for object rexx for microsoft windows.

The fifth annual rexx symposium for developers and users convened in boston. Since windows is a closed, proprietary operating system, programming languages that are most useful on windows include windowsspecific extensions. Some of the examples are intended for learning purposes, while others were designed as subroutines or code you can copy and use. Open object rexx supports all the required windowsspecific capabilities. All ibm rexx manuals for os, vm, vse, cics, os2, os unix. Apply to system programmer, computer programmer, programmer analyst and more. Introduction the rexx language has many features that make it a powerful programming tool. Ibm compiler and library for rexx on zseries v1 r4 users guide and reference. The chapter s in this part cover the following topics. It is a structured, highlevel programming language designed for ease of learning and reading. As a result of a feud between the two companies over how to position os2 relative to microsofts new windows 3. A scheduled task is added to windows task scheduler in order to launch the program at various scheduled times the schedule varies depending on the version. The following passport advantage part numbers are being replaced or made obsolete by this announcement. First off, it has nothing to do with those big green lizards that ran around angrily eating other lizards presumably because their pathetically small arms gave them some kind of appendage envy rexx is a kinda cool interpretive language a bit like control language clp.

It leverages the runtime library that houses routines called by the compiled programs. This part of the book is for programmers who want to learn the rexx language. Ibm compiler and library for rexx on ibm z pricing. Ibm compiler and library for rexx on ibm z overview. Os2 is a series of computer operating systems, initially created by microsoft and ibm, then later developed by ibm exclusively. The compiler translates rexx source programs into compiled programs.

Rexx is an interpreted, procedural structured language that is included with every version of os2 ee 1. Can i redistribute oorexx freely with commercial software. The latest version of ibm object rexx for windows development edition update is 2. Overview ibm drives mainframe development and test into the cloud whilst ensuring high velocity development is achievable for zos organizations. Automating ibm 3990 dasd recovery using rexx programs and netview. The object rexx programming language is an object oriented scripting language initially produced by ibm for the operating system os2. Rexxsql tools like the database manager in os2 extended edition. Object rexx for windows nt and windows 95 ibm itso red. An interpreted language is different from other programming languages, such as cobol, because it is not necessary to compile a rexx command list before executing it. The syntax of a function declaration is as follows. Ibm object rexx for windows development edition version 2. This course is designed to enable the attendee to write advanced rexx procedures which interface to the operating system in various ways, including file io, the use of ispf panels and dialogs, edit macros, jcl modifications, submitting jcl using the stack and the mvs internal reader and complex parsing templates using table variables.

Os2 is no longer marketed by ibm, and ibm standard support for os2 was. Ibm compiler and library for rexx on ibm z resources. Rexx restructured extended executor is an interpreted programming language developed at ibm by mike cowlishaw. The rexx language is a versatile generalpurpose programming language that can be used by new and experienced programmers. And the attendees continued the symposium tradition of contributing software. The project is managed by the rexx language association. Please note that the builds are produced on a nightly basis. Its sample spreadsheet gives you an easy way to determine if larger memory would be suitable. This lead to amongst other things the development of the corba derived. We can help you find the right edition and pricing for your business needs. Open object rexx runs under unix, linux, and windows. This session discusses the reasons why rexx was chosen to develop ibm rational team concerts ispf client. He is responsible for object rexx on windows nt and windows 95.

The source code for object rexx for microsoft windows, aix. Rexx terminology this document uses several terms that have a specific meaning when discussing rexx. Ibm contributes scripting language to the rexx language. Os2 is a series of computer operating systems, initially created by microsoft and ibm under the leadership of ibm software designer ed iacobucci. There are already several books that do cover rexx explicitly from an os2 perspective. Ibm alternate library for rexx on zseries version 1. Playing with rexx on ibm i nick litten is ibmi, as400.

Ibm object rexx now runs on windows nt and windows 95. The syntax and object model of netrexx differ from object rexx. Ibm offers object rexx for windows r in two editions for windows nt and windows 95, interpreter edition and development edition. Ibm object rexx ibm united states withdrawal announcement 904207 october 12, 2004. Ibm supplies a set of external functions for use with sa iom. Trevor turton works as an it architect in the area of network computing for ibm south africa. This annual fee covers the zos, zvm, and zvse and parallel system starter system sw stacks and is regardless if one, two, or all four adcd stacks are requested. Announcing ibm z development and test environment v12 z. Rexx restructured extended executor is developed at ibm. The ibm object rexx development edition includes the interpreter edition and provides a graphical dialog editor and a programmers workbench with debug features.

This package provides a rexx to be run using the db2 display buffer pool command output. It was initially added to our database on 10292007. It is developed in lock step with z hardware, offering unmatched application portability and. Built to the highest standards of security and performance, so you can be confident that. This ibm redbooks publication describes the new support and provides sample rexx execs that exploit the new function and that perform realworld tasks related to operations, systems. Object rexx for windows was first announced in february 1997. Useful projects for those new to rexx and the mainframe. It is upwardly compatible with classic rexx and will execute classic rexx programs unchanged. The name stands for operating system2, because it was introduced as part of the same generation change release as ibms personal system2 ps2 line of secondgeneration personal computers. Object rexx for windows nt and windows 95 ibm itso red book. What is the difference between oorexx and ibm s object rexx for windows.

Ibm object rexx for windows v2r1 object oriented programming for beginners to. The first version of os2 was released in december 1987 and newer. Object rexx is an interpreted scripting language based on programming language rexx, ansi x3. Using rexx for ibm mainframe application development. We have 1 ibm rexx manual available for free pdf download.

It is upwardly compatible with classic rexx and will execute classic rexx. The object rexx programming language is an objectoriented scripting language initially produced by ibm for the operating. This thing must be ready in your mind before you start any coding, either in rexx, or in whatever else. The object rexx programming language is an objectoriented scripting language initially produced by ibm for the operating system os2. On the other hand ibm donated object rexx for windows and os2 to the. Ibm object rexx for windows development edition update is a shareware software in the category miscellaneous developed by ibm. Object rexx for windows development edition software. Apply to system programmer, administrator, senior programmer analyst and more. Object rexx iswas an objectoriented scripting language initially produced by ibm for os2. Later, ibm developed versions of os2 that would use whatever windows version.

996 1372 580 1004 1474 692 469 984 191 487 1301 1063 1441 468 1090 1114 516 488 281 1406 959 645 1474 652 936 1264 1183 1272 559 714 998 537 96 1364 1263 324